New Jersey S2288 removes the requirement for local government officers to disclose their home or secondary residence addresses on financial disclosure statements. It also exempts judicial and law enforcement officers from disclosing their home addresses under any circumstances. The bill applies to financial disclosure statements filed in 2023 and thereafter.
